20.01.2022 After 13 years working in media and marketing in the north of Queensland, former Chronicle journalist Georgina Claxton yearned for her home town of Maryborough.... She was homesick for the grand sense of community amid the beautiful heritage buildings. Three-and-a-half years ago she came home, set up the Fresh café in Station Square and has never been happier. She works seven days a week, revels in living in a renovated Queenslander and says she’s living the dream. She and her son Jay start work at 6am seven days a week, bake all the food in the shop (except the gluten-free lines) and soak up the compliments from a steady clientele. She says 70% of her regular customers are older folk: We really look after them. They have become like extended family. Customer service, home recipes that I made when I was a kid, good coffee and competitive prices are part of the popular Fresh mix. Sausage rolls and pies are serious favourites. I love Maryborough, she beams. I have fantastic staff so I finish early and sometimes just stroll around and enjoy the town. People should take more time to soak up the atmosphere and buildings. I took the dogs to Queen’s Park the other day and thought ‘How good is this?’ We have everything here. If you can’t get it in Maryborough you can in Hervey Bay and it stays in the regional economy. If not, Sunshine Coast and Brisbane are easy to reach. Maryborough shouldn’t under-estimate the opportunity to court Hervey Bay customers: I have one Hervey Bay customer who comes up fairly regularly and buys everything in the bain marie. I now get him to call before he comes so I can bake extra. After a disastrous opening day, Georgina was optimistic. I opened my PR business in Cairns at the same time as (the) September 11 (terror attack) and not long after Ansett collapsed. Both events really rocked Cairns but I stayed with it and the business became successful. My first day with Fresh was the day of that huge storm in the morning. I was on acreage then and my house flooded but I still came in and of course we had no customers. I thought ‘I’ve had the worst possible start again. This business should be right too. And it was.
